Winning is always nice, but doing so behind a season-high score is even better (just ask Hamlin). They blew past the DeSmet Bulldogs 88-47 on Tuesday. The win was nothing new for the Chargers as they're now sitting on three straight.

Hamlin's victory was their 11th straight at home dating back to last season, which pushed their record up to 8-2. The wins came thanks to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 76.8 points per game. As for DeSmet, their loss ended a six-game streak of away wins dating back to last season and brought them to 4-6.
